MILO and cricket - a great partnership

Are you mad for cricket? We are! The association between MILO and cricket in New Zealand began in Auckland in 1986. Since 1999, MILO has been an integral part of New Zealand Cricket's national junior development program.

MILO Have-A-Go Cricket

MILO Have-A-Go Cricket is an introductory program open to all 5 to 8 year old boys and girls.

MILO Kiwi Cricket

MILO Kiwi Cricket is a cricket competition for 7 to 10 year olds.

MILO Cup and Shield

The MILO National Primary Schools Cricket Championships is where 11 to 13 years old compete to win the MILO Cup (for boys) and the MILO Shield (for girls).

MILO Summer Squad

The MILO Summer Squad is an initiative designed to train parents and teachers to become coaches in the MILO Have-A-Go and Kiwi Cricket programs.
